Order by

Terms

Definitions

Popular Sovereignty a government in which the people rule
Republicanism the people exercise their power by voting for their political representative
Federalism a system of government in which the states and national governments share powers: delegated, reserved, concurrent
Separation of Powers the division of basic government roles into three branches: legislative, executive, and judicial
Checks and Balances power is evenly distributed between the three branches of government; the three branches are separate but rely on one another to perform the work of government
limited government the power of government is restricted; no one is above the law
Individual rights personal liberties are guaranteed and protected by the Bill of Rights from an overly powerful government
